Kielbasa Sheet-Pan Dinner

Kelly Schmidt
Hands-off sheet-pan dinner.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 35 minutes
Course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 4 servings

Equipment

  • Baking sheet

Ingredients
  

  • 3 ea Kielbasa links I love the brand from Costco. I use half of the package per dinner and freeze the reaming links for a future meal.
  • 1 pkge frozen lentil, pea mix We love these from Trader Joe's. Feel free to throw on a can of white beans and peas instead if you do not have this option.
  • 1 ea yellow onion, chopped
  • 2 cups shaved Brussels sprouts
  • 1 tbsp avocado oil
  • 1/2 tsp sea salt
  • 1 tbsp fresh lemon

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 400F.
  • Spray baking pan (or drizzle) with avocado oil
  • Chop and slice all of the above ingredients with the exception of the lemon.
  • Layer ingredients onto the pan, then top with sea salt and more avocado oil if desired.
  • Bake sheet pan for 30-35 minutes.
  • Once the vegetables are cooked through and the pan is fully cooked, squirt fresh lemon over the ingredients before serving.

Notes

For ingredient combinations, we usually always have onion and a cruciferous vegetable. Go with whatever vegetables you like best. This meal is great with cabbage and broccoli as well.
